MEMO — Records Team, Corvane Aerials. Survey drone unit "Kite-7" has been returned for servicing after intermittent gimbal faults reported by the Relling field crew. The airframe, two batteries, and the controller are packed in the original transit case, seals verified at intake and numbers entered in the service ledger. Firmware logs were exported before shipment and filed under the maintenance record. Collection by Bramhall Couriers is scheduled for 10:45 tomorrow. Please record completion of the hand-over instruction that follows below.

dispatch memo: the quenvan holax courier leaves the zoreth briath kasvan ledger at gate 7481 under passcode 618862

**Onboarding: Retry Safety in PayLoom**

Quick one for our security review: every payment retry in PayLoom must reuse the original idempotency key, or the gateway treats it as a fresh charge. Keys live in the retry vault, scoped per merchant. If the vault is sealed after an incident, unseal it with the recovery passphrase listed directly below.

strongbox words: ulaael-caswyn

# Break-Glass: Catalog Cache Invalidation

Scope: the Pinrow product catalog at Veldstone Retail. If stale prices persist after a purge and the Hollowmere invalidation queue is wedged, use break-glass to flush the edge tier directly. Contractors: get verbal sign-off from the catalog lead first. Steps: open the Hollowmere admin shell, select emergency-flush, confirm the tenant, and run it once — repeated flushes thrash the origin. Access is logged and expires after 20 minutes. Unseal the admin shell with the passphrase below.

recovery phrase for kahop-tajog: istix-casvan

## Deploying the Gatewick Proctor Queue

Deploys are pretty painless: push to main, wait for the pipeline, then watch the queue drain dashboard for five minutes. If candidates pile up mid-exam, roll back first and ask questions later — the queue replays safely. Everything the workers care about lives in one config block, shown here for reference.

settings of bafof-yagef:
JOROX_PIN=8740
JOROX_TENANT=pelox
JOROX_METRICS_HOST=metrics.jorox.qorvelworks.internal
JOROX_SEAL=seal_c78f63c1
JOROX_STANDBY_TEAM=norax